Transaction 5a66923f2477fba89fda80090736a5e60cd2148576e6ae7be6934155cde87ff3
1 Input
1 Output
-
5a66923f2477fba89fda80090736a5e60cd2148576e6ae7be6934155cde87ff3:0
- value
- 50437663
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d80ff0d5d4e87d7d7bdad25cf07c60e8c73f67e2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LhS426sof4PNSczihXqtbdnRVxd5kmVCm